    This week, the girls talk to Maia Szalavitz; a neuroscience journalist and author of the New York Times bestseller, Unbroken Brain: A Revolutionary New Way of Understanding Addiction. Maia specializes in covering the intersection between brain and behavior and how social factors like inequality get under the skin. She is the author or co-author of six other books and writes for major publications including the Guardian, TIME, the New York Times, Scientific American Mind, the Washington Post, VICE and Pacific Standard.

    In the last episode of 2017, Jeff DeFlavio returns to HOME. Jeff is the founder and CEO of Groups, a company that provides affordable, modernized treatment for opiate use. This episode is a mashup of talk about the opiate epidemic, politics, keeping focus and heart when the battle is so big, and some book reviews (wherein Jeff mistakes Hillbilly Elegy for Dreamland for most of the episode), and more.
